>   i'm still curious if anyone ran into the same error i did yesterday
> -- that, while installing on a system with no net connection, after i
> selected the default partitioning and the filesystems were formatted,
> i was *immediately* told to configure my networking since my software
> repos required a net connection.
> 
>   i hadn't even made my software selections yet.  and there was no way
> to cancel the net configuration.  i had to abort the install and start
> over.  that happened several times.

With older images I ran into this, there was a bug on i386 of finding
the media repo (due to i586 vs i386).  That's why it would pop the
network, if it doesn't detect local install media that matches.
